Aeroplane Heaven Cessna 140 G-BTBV

This is a repaint for the Aeroplane Heaven Cessna 140 (MSFS) to represent G-BTBV in her striking scarlet and white livery. Cessna 140 C/N 12727 was built in 1947 and originally registered N2474N. Although still UK-registered, I believe 'BV is based in Germany.

There's no paintkit or plain white textures for this model so I made the skin from bits of the FSX paintkit and whichever of the included textures were easiest to clean up. Most of the heavy lifting is done by AH's base textures, COMPs and NORMs, which seem excellent.

The real aircraft has the wing root fairings painted red to match the fuselage but the front of the fairings are mapped to part of the wing leading edge so I had to leave them white. There's also a QV code on the cowling (that's what it looks like, anyway..) which is larger in real life, but I lost the will to live trying to find the 5 rivets I needed silver instead of red!

INSTALLATION

Simply unzip the download and drop the 'AH-Cessna140-GBTBV' folder into your MSFS 'Community' folder and you should be good to go. Repaint by Steve Mercer based on textures created by Aeroplane Heaven.
